Description
Technical field
The utility model relates to cleaning equipment accessory technical field, is specifically related to the tooling basket of a kind of rotation.
Background technology
Tooling basket is generally used on the auto-plant needing stirring and washing workpiece technique, after needing artificial loading workpiece, tooling basket is mentioned again by grapple, rotating bezel in tooling basket can rock in rotation, it is unfavorable for the movement of tooling basket, especially in high speed handling process, tooling basket is difficult to held stationary, adds the difficulty of carrying at a high speed.
Summary of the invention
The purpose of this utility model is the defect for prior art and deficiency, it is provided that the tooling basket of a kind of rotation, and it when tooling basket hand basket, can automatically lock tooling basket, makes to stablize when tooling basket translation or lifting not rock, ensure that the steady of handling process.
For achieving the above object, the technical solution adopted in the utility model is: it comprises rotary electric machine, grapple, locating mechanism, rotating bezel, equipment gear, chain; Rotary electric machine is connected with locating mechanism, and grapple is arranged on the top of locating mechanism, and equipment gear is arranged on the both sides of rotating bezel, and locating mechanism is connected with rotating bezel by chain and equipment gear; Described locating mechanism comprises driving toothed gear, main drive shaft, locating sleeve, square base bearing, upper driven wheel, auxiliary hook, bearing support, the 2nd spring, upper limit retaining plate, upper positioning tooth, upper limit tooth; Driving toothed gear is connected with rotary electric machine, and driving toothed gear is connected with locating sleeve by main drive shaft, and square base bearing is arranged on the right side of locating sleeve, is connected with upper driven wheel; Upper limit tooth is located in locating sleeve, and diaxon bearing is located at the both sides of upper limit tooth, and the bottom of two auxiliary hooks is respectively equipped with the 2nd spring, and the lower end of the 2nd spring is connected with upper limit retaining plate, and upper positioning tooth is arranged on upper limit retaining plate.
Described rotating bezel is made up of upper connecting rod, lower link, guiding axle, spring, workpiece basket and gland; Upper connecting rod and lower link are horizontally disposed with up and down, the vertical parallel setting of axle of three guiding, and the upper end of guiding axle is connected with upper connecting rod, and the bottom of guiding axle is provided with spring, is connected with lower link by spring; Workpiece basket is arranged between connecting rod and lower link, between adjacent two guiding axles, the top of workpiece basket is provided with gland.
Workflow of the present utility model is:
1. when workpiece is laid up, automatically open gland, after dress workpiece, by the deadweight of tooling basket, it is achieved automatically close gland after mentioning tooling basket;
2. after tooling basket being put into tank, tooling basket in tank, the equipment gear that tooling basket stretches out just with rotary electric machine gears meshing, rotating bezel can be driven to rotate according to cleaning, with reach stir workpiece cleaning effect;
3. after having cleaned, during grapple hand basket, can catch together with the auxiliary hook on locating mechanism, make the upper positioning tooth of connection auxiliary hook moves, engage with upper limit tooth, thus tooling basket is not rotated.
After adopting said structure, the useful effect of the utility model is: it when tooling basket hand basket, can automatically lock tooling basket, makes to stablize when tooling basket translation or lifting not rock, ensure that the steady of handling process.
